1. Introduction

The Aduro Bluetooth Audio Receiver allows you to wirelessly stream audio from your Bluetooth-enabled devices to any audio system with a 3.5mm auxiliary input. This device converts traditional audio systems into Bluetooth-compatible systems, enabling seamless music playback from smartphones, tablets, and other Bluetooth audio sources.

Key features include:

  • Makes any media device with a 3.5mm jack Bluetooth-capable.
  • Receives music from Bluetooth sources such as smartphones and tablets.
  • Compatible with playback devices like headphones, speakers, and car stereos.
  • Bluetooth 2.1 with Advanced Audio Distribution Profile (A2DP) for enhanced audio quality.
  • Up to 30 feet (9 meters) wireless range.
  • One-touch pairing control for easy connection.
  • Plugs directly into any standard 3.5mm audio jack.
  • Provides up to 12 hours of audio playback on a full charge.

3. Setup

3.1 Charging the Receiver

Before initial use, fully charge the Aduro Bluetooth Audio Receiver. A full charge provides up to 12 hours of audio playback.

  1. Connect the small end of the provided USB charging cable to the micro-USB port on the receiver.
  2. Connect the standard USB end of the cable to a USB power source (e.g., computer USB port, USB wall adapter).
  3. The indicator light on the receiver will illuminate during charging and turn off when fully charged.

3.2 Connecting to an Audio System

The receiver connects to your audio system via a standard 3.5mm auxiliary input.

  1. Locate the 3.5mm auxiliary input jack on your desired audio system (e.g., car stereo, home speaker, headphones).
  2. Plug the integrated 3.5mm audio jack of the Aduro Bluetooth Audio Receiver directly into the auxiliary input.
  3. Ensure the audio system is set to the auxiliary input source.

4. Operating Instructions

4.1 Powering On/Off

  • To Power On: Press and hold the power button (often marked with a power symbol) on the receiver until the indicator light flashes.
  • To Power Off: Press and hold the power button again until the indicator light turns off.

4.2 Pairing with a Bluetooth Device

The Aduro Bluetooth Audio Receiver uses one-touch pairing for easy connection to your smartphone, tablet, or other Bluetooth audio source.

  1. Ensure the receiver is powered on and within 30 feet (9 meters) of your Bluetooth audio source.
  2. The indicator light will typically flash rapidly, indicating it is in pairing mode.
  3. On your Bluetooth audio source (e.g., smartphone), go to the Bluetooth settings menu.
  4. Scan for available devices. The receiver should appear as "Aduro Bluetooth Receiver" or similar.
  5. Select the receiver from the list to initiate pairing.
  6. Once successfully paired, the indicator light on the receiver will typically change to a slow flash or solid blue, depending on the model.
  7. If prompted for a passcode, enter "0000" (four zeros).

Note: The receiver will attempt to reconnect to the last paired device automatically when powered on.

4.3 Playing Audio

After successful pairing, you can begin streaming audio:

  1. Ensure your audio system is set to the correct auxiliary input.
  2. Start playing audio from your paired Bluetooth device.
  3. Adjust the volume on both your Bluetooth device and the connected audio system for optimal sound.

5. Maintenance

  • Cleaning: Use a soft, dry cloth to clean the surface of the receiver. Do not use liquid cleaners or aerosols.
  • Storage: Store the device in a cool, dry place when not in use.
  • Battery Care: To prolong battery life, avoid fully discharging the battery frequently. Recharge the device when the low battery indicator appears.
